Unauthenticated command execution via SetTriggerLEDBlink input
Published Dec 14, 2022 · Updated Apr 22, 2025
Command injection in D-Link DIR-3040 firmware 1.20B03 allows remote attackers to execute device commands through SetTriggerLEDBlink. The public record identifies SetTriggerLEDBlink as the injection locus but does not disclose the tainted request field or unsafe command-building operation. Network reachability is the only published gate; successful injection can read or alter device data and interrupt service.
